Private tour to Muyil Ruins and Sian Kaan River

If you want to truly dive into the Mayan culture, you absolutely need to book our tour of the Muyil Ruins. We are combining the Muyil ruins with  a boat tour in the Sian Kaan reserve, including the floating through the mayan canals.

Muyil ruins are one of the oldest Mayan sites in the area and contains natural artifacts dating back 4th Century BC. This area showcases the need for survival in the Mayan culture as it includes canals the Mayans used to connect this inland city to the coast. This was prominent as it allowed for trade to occur!

After you have become engulfed in the culture, our experienced guide will take you walking through the jungle and mangrove to the lagoon.

In order to allow you to have an even more memorable time, once arrived at the lagoons of the Sian Kaan Biosphere Reserve, our tour allows for our patrons to experience a private boat tour of the reserve’s lagoons and a visit to another small Mayan temple.

Translating to “where the sky is born,” Sian Kaan is one of the area’s most beautiful landscapes. The biosphere is now known for its diverse vegetation and wildlife. We will also get into the water and float in one of the canals to get cooler, and this is actually quite fun as the current swims for you!
